Understanding the Units: Pounds and Kilograms



Before diving into the conversion, let's briefly define the units involved. The pound (lb) is a unit of mass in the imperial system, commonly used in the United States and a few other countries. The kilogram (kg), on the other hand, is the base unit of mass in the International System of Units (SI), the most widely used system globally. Understanding the difference is essential for accurate conversions. One key difference is that the pound is a unit of avoirdupois weight, specifically designed for measuring common goods, while the kilogram is a more fundamental unit applicable across scientific and everyday measurements.

The Conversion Factor: The Bridge Between Pounds and Kilograms



The conversion between pounds and kilograms is straightforward, relying on a constant conversion factor. One kilogram is approximately equal to 2.20462 pounds. This means that to convert pounds to kilograms, we divide the weight in pounds by this conversion factor. Conversely, to convert kilograms to pounds, we multiply the weight in kilograms by this factor. For our specific example of 127 lbs, we will use division.

Calculating 127 lbs to kg: A Step-by-Step Guide



To convert 127 lbs to kilograms, we perform the following calculation:

127 lbs / 2.20462 lbs/kg ≈ 57.6 kg

Therefore, 127 pounds is approximately equal to 57.6 kilograms. Note that we use the approximation symbol (≈) because the conversion factor is a decimal approximation. For most practical purposes, this level of accuracy is sufficient. However, for scientific applications requiring higher precision, more decimal places in the conversion factor might be necessary.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)



1. Is the conversion factor 2.20462 exact? No, it's an approximation. The exact conversion factor is a slightly longer decimal, but 2.20462 is precise enough for most everyday purposes.

2. Can I use an online converter instead of calculating manually? Yes, many online converters are readily available for quick and accurate conversions between pounds and kilograms.

3. What if I need to convert kilograms to pounds? To convert kilograms to pounds, multiply the weight in kilograms by 2.20462.

4. Why are there different units for weight? Historically, different regions developed their own systems of measurement. The adoption of the SI system (using kilograms) is an ongoing process aimed at standardizing measurements globally.

5. What's the difference between mass and weight? Mass is the amount of matter in an object, while weight is the force of gravity acting on that mass. While often used interchangeably, they are distinct concepts. The conversion between pounds and kilograms primarily deals with mass.
